  • About Us

    WCST is dedicated to ending the cycle of domestic violence and sexual assault through intervention, prevention education, and safe shelter.

    WCST was formed in 1977 as the Women's Coalition of Josephine County, and operated entirely as a volunteer program and hot line for rape victims. In 1980 the organization changed its name, expanded its scope, and incorporated as a 501 (c)3 non-profit organization, dedicated to the struggle against both domestic violence and sexual assault.

    WCST has evolved into one of the community's most active, recognized, and respected non-profit organizations. One thing will never change; WCST's commitment to helping survivors of domestic violence and sexual assault and to mitigating the physical, emotional and societal damage caused by violence in the home.
